After macOS migration: installation script failed: error: the build users group 'nixbld' has no members #6078

@drichardson

Description

@drichardson

Describe the bug

The installation script failed.

Reporting here per the instructions as the bottom of the output.

Steps To Reproduce

  1. Install nix on mac A
  2. Run macOS Migration Assistant to migrate data to mac B
  3. On mac B, run nix installer.

NOTE: It's highly likely (2) was an aborted Migration.

Fails with:

error: the build users group 'nixbld' has no members

Expected behavior

Installation should succeed.

nix-env --version output

N/A because nix not installed yet.

---- Preparing a Nix volume ----------------------------------------------------
    Nix traditionally stores its data in the root directory /nix, but
    macOS now (starting in 10.15 Catalina) has a read-only root directory.
    To support Nix, I will create a volume and configure macOS to mount it
    at /nix.
